网站建设公司-山而百度地图怎么看上次导航的路线

张小明 2025/12/31 20:49:53
网站建设公司-山而,百度地图怎么看上次导航的路线,网站维护的具体方法,东莞百度网站快速优化csp信奥赛C标准模板库STL案例应用21 next_permutation实践 题目描述 按照字典序输出自然数 1 1 1 到 n n n 所有不重复的排列#xff0c;即 n n n 的全排列#xff0c;要求所产生的任一数字序列中不允许出现重复的数字。 输入格式 一个整数 n n n。 输出格式 由 1…csp信奥赛C标准模板库STL案例应用21next_permutation实践题目描述按照字典序输出自然数1 11到n nn所有不重复的排列即n nn的全排列要求所产生的任一数字序列中不允许出现重复的数字。输入格式一个整数n nn。输出格式由1 ∼ n 1 \sim n1∼n组成的所有不重复的数字序列每行一个序列。每个数字保留5 55个场宽。输入输出样例 1输入 13输出 11 2 3 1 3 2 2 1 3 2 3 1 3 1 2 3 2 1说明/提示1 ≤ n ≤ 9 1 \leq n \leq 91≤n≤9。核心思路初始化序列创建包含1到n的有序向量生成排列利用next_permutation按字典序生成所有排列格式输出使用setw控制输出格式满足题目要求时间复杂度O(n! × n)共有n!个排列每个排列输出需要O(n)时间空间复杂度O(n)只使用了一个大小为n的向量代码实现#includebits/stdc.h// 包含所有标准库头文件竞赛常用写法usingnamespacestd;intn;// 全局变量存储输入的nintmain(){cinn;// 读入nvectorinta;// 创建整型向量a用于存储当前排列// 初始化向量a为[1, 2, ..., n]for(inti1;in;i){a.push_back(i);// 将1到n依次加入向量}// 使用do-while循环生成所有排列// do-while保证至少执行一次先输出初始排列do{// 输出当前排列for(inti0;in;i){// 使用setw(5)设置输出宽度为5个字符右对齐coutsetw(5)a[i];}coutendl;// 每个排列后换行// next_permutation将向量a变为字典序的下一个排列// 当没有下一个排列时返回false循环结束}while(next_permutation(a.begin(),a.end()));return0;}功能分析1.输入处理读取一个整数n范围1≤n≤9较小的n值保证了算法在可接受时间内完成9! 3628802.排列生成机制next_permutation原理按字典序生成下一个排列初始状态向量a为升序排列[1,2,…,n]终止条件当序列变为降序排列时函数返回false特性自动处理重复元素本题中无重复数字3.输出格式化场宽控制setw(5)确保每个数字占5个字符宽度对齐方式默认右对齐符合题目要求行格式每个数字后无额外空格一行一个排列4.算法特点简洁性利用标准库函数代码量少正确性按字典序生成所有排列与题目要求一致通用性适用于任何可比较的元素类型示例流程n3初始状态[1,2,3]第一次循环输出1 2 3next_permutation生成[1,3,2]第二次循环输出1 3 2依此类推直到[3,2,1]后结束完整系列资料请查看专栏《csp信奥赛C标准模板库STL》https://blog.csdn.net/weixin_66461496/category_13108077.html各种学习资料助力大家一站式学习和提升#includebits/stdc.husingnamespacestd;intmain(){cout########## 一站式掌握信奥赛知识! ##########;cout############# 冲刺信奥赛拿奖! #############;cout###### 课程购买后永久学习不受限制! ######;return0;}一、CSP信奥赛C通关学习视频课C语法基础C语法进阶C算法C数据结构CSP信奥赛数学CSP信奥赛STL二、CSP信奥赛C竞赛拿奖视频课信奥赛csp-j初赛高频考点解析CSP信奥赛C复赛集训课12大高频考点专题集训三、考级、竞赛刷题题单及题解GESP C考级真题题解CSP信奥赛C初赛及复赛高频考点真题解析CSP信奥赛C一等奖通关刷题题单及题解详细内容1、csp/信奥赛C完整信奥赛系列课程永久学习https://edu.csdn.net/lecturer/7901 点击跳转2、CSP信奥赛C竞赛拿奖视频课https://edu.csdn.net/course/detail/40437 点击跳转3、csp信奥赛冲刺一等奖有效刷题题解CSP信奥赛C初赛及复赛高频考点真题解析持续更新https://blog.csdn.net/weixin_66461496/category_12808781.html 点击跳转2025 csp-j 复赛真题及答案解析最新更新2025 csp-x(山东) 复赛真题及答案解析最新更新2025 csp-x(河南) 复赛真题及答案解析最新更新2025 csp-x(辽宁) 复赛真题及答案解析最新更新2025 csp-x(江西) 复赛真题及答案解析最新更新2025 csp-x(广西) 复赛真题及答案解析最新更新2020 ~ 2024 csp 复赛真题题单及题解2019 ~ 2022 csp-j 初赛高频考点真题分类解析2021 ~ 2024 csp-s 初赛高频考点解析2023 ~ 2024 csp-x (山东)初赛真题及答案解析2024 csp-j 初赛真题及答案解析2025 csp-j 初赛真题及答案解析最新更新2025 csp-s 初赛真题及答案解析最新更新2025 csp-x (山东)初赛真题及答案解析(最新更新)2025 csp-x (江西)初赛真题及答案解析(最新更新)2025 csp-x (辽宁)初赛真题及答案解析(最新更新)CSP信奥赛C一等奖通关刷题题单及题解持续更新https://blog.csdn.net/weixin_66461496/category_12673810.html 点击跳转129 道刷题练习和详细题解涉及模拟算法、数学思维、二分算法、 前缀和、差分、深搜、广搜、DP专题、 树和图4、GESP C考级真题题解GESP(C 一级二级三级)真题题解持续更新https://blog.csdn.net/weixin_66461496/category_12858102.html 点击跳转GESP(C 四级五级六级)真题题解持续更新https://blog.csdn.net/weixin_66461496/category_12869848.html 点击跳转· 文末祝福 ·#includebits/stdc.husingnamespacestd;intmain(){cout跟着王老师一起学习信奥赛C;cout 成就更好的自己 ;cout csp信奥赛一等奖属于你! ;return0;}
版权声明:本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若内容造成侵权/违法违规/事实不符,请联系邮箱:809451989@qq.com进行投诉反馈,一经查实,立即删除!

深圳网站设计网站网站推广招商

Armbian系统救援:3大技巧让电视盒子秒变稳定服务器 🛠️ 【免费下载链接】amlogic-s9xxx-armbian amlogic-s9xxx-armbian: 该项目提供了为Amlogic、Rockchip和Allwinner盒子构建的Armbian系统镜像,支持多种设备,允许用户将安卓TV系…

张小明 2025/12/30 19:57:19 网站建设

上海泵阀网站建设什么是网站流量优化

第一章:教育AI Agent的学习推荐概述随着人工智能技术在教育领域的深入应用,教育AI Agent正逐步成为个性化学习的核心驱动力。这类智能体通过分析学生的学习行为、知识掌握程度和认知偏好,动态生成定制化的学习路径与资源推荐,显著…

张小明 2025/12/30 19:56:44 网站建设

仿新浪全站网站源码庆阳网站设计公司

终极PPT演讲时间管理神器:免费悬浮计时器完整指南 【免费下载链接】ppttimer 一个简易的 PPT 计时器 项目地址: https://gitcode.com/gh_mirrors/pp/ppttimer 还在为演讲超时而焦虑吗?每次重要演示时,是否总在担心时间失控影响整体表现…

张小明 2025/12/30 19:56:10 网站建设

山西网站建设软件重庆新华网

在学习 JavaScript 的过程中,你是否曾被以下现象困惑过?typeof Object; // "function" typeof {}; // "object"明明 Object 是“对象”的代表,为什么它自己却是个函数? 而 {} 才是我们日常使用的“对…

张小明 2025/12/30 19:55:36 网站建设

周易网站建设用自己网站域名这么做邮箱

告别Vim多文件编辑困扰!这些缓冲区管理神器让你效率翻倍 🚀 【免费下载链接】vim-airline 项目地址: https://gitcode.com/gh_mirrors/vim/vim-airline 还在为Vim中同时打开十几个文件而头疼吗?每次切换缓冲区都要输入繁琐的命令&…

张小明 2025/12/30 19:54:29 网站建设

厦门市住房与城乡建设局网站商品列表页面html模板

第一章:Open-AutoGLM 弹窗自动处理算法设计在自动化测试与智能交互系统中,弹窗的不可预测性常导致流程中断。Open-AutoGLM 引擎引入了一套基于语义理解与视觉特征融合的弹窗自动处理算法,旨在实现对多样化弹窗的精准识别与智能响应。核心设计…

张小明 2025/12/30 19:53:56 网站建设